1 Chronicles 11:21 — Bible Verse (KJV)
“Of the three, he was more honourable than the two; for he was their captain: howbeit he attained not to the first three.”

1 Chronicles 11:21 WEB — World English Bible (2000)
“Of the three, he was more honorable than the two, and was made their captain; however he wasn’t included in the three.”

1 Chronicles 11:21 ASV — American Standard Version (1901)
“Of the three, he was more honorable than the two, and was made their captain: howbeit he attained not to the first three.”

1 Chronicles 11:21 YLT — Young's Literal Translation (1862)
“Of the three by the two he is honoured, and becometh their head; and unto the <FI>first<Fi> three he hath not come.”

1 Chronicles 11:21 DBY — Darby Translation (1890)
“Of the three he was more honourable than the two, and he was their captain; but he did not attain to the [first] three.”

1 Chronicles 11:21 GEN — Geneva Bible (1599)
“Among the three he was more honourable then the two, and he was their captaine: but he attained not vnto the first three.”
